NEWS
Test Adapter lovelace v1.2.x
-
@ehome Ich probiere es mal:
In der Admin-Ansicht auf "Adapter". Dann oben auf das Symbol mit der "Katze"Dann öffnet sich ein neuer Dialog. Dort gibt es auf dem ersten Reiter die Auswahl "Github".
Dann kannst du unten "Lovelace" in der Box suchen und dann installieren klicken.
Damit wird die aktuelle DEV installiert. -
Hallo Zusammen,
erstmal vielen Dank für den tollen Adapter.
Für mich die Visualisierung, die State-of-The-Art ist!Ich bin nun auch auf der DEV-Version 1.2.5
Durch das Update habe ich Probleme bei einfachen Konstellationen.
Im folgenden habe ich einen Sensor (Wassersensor):
Dieser wurde über den "Schraubenschlüssel" wie folgt konfiguriert:
In der DEV-Version macht er daraus:
Im stabilen Lovelace-Adapter wird daraus die Entität
"sensor.Basement_Watersensor_01_water"
=> D.h. es fehlt ein "unterstrich" zwischen Objektid und dem attribut.
Das führt natürlich dazu, dass Reihenweise die bisherigen Lovelace Karten nicht mehr funktionieren:
Wenn man den Namen nun ändern könnte wäre es für mich ok, aber anscheinend sind keine Leerzeichen in den Entitäten erlaubt:
-
Hey,
die neue Version sieht wirklich super aus!Gleichwohl habe ich immer noch das Problem mit ACCU-Weather:
Raum Any und Funktion Weather wurden eingestellt. Auch die Custom-Card wurde installiert. Leider erkennt der Detector aber nicht das Objekt:[Type-Detector] device accuweather.0.Summary.CurrentDateTime - info - accuweather.0.Summary is not yet supported
Des Weiteren habe ich leider nur einen Zustandsverlauf bei Sensorwerten, wo die History im Datenpunkt selbst aktiv ist.
Wie klappt das bei Hue-Lampen oder bei Rollladen?Lösung: - > Einfach beim entsprechenden Gerät / Typ die History aktivieren.
Leider wird der Shelly-Dimmer nicht mehr korrekt erkannt. Gibt es eine Möglichkeit den TypeDector manuell anzupassen?
Viele Grüße
Jan -
Hi, ich habe eine technische Frage, vielleicht kann mir ja einer weiterhelfen.
Ich möchte mit einem Schalter nicht schalten, sondern nur triggern (kurzes Ein und dann wieder aus). Geht das wirklich nur über ein zusätzliches Skript der den Status von einem Datenobjekt überwacht und ihn dann wieder zurücksetzt oder habe ich irgendwas übersehen?
Die Aktion Call-service funktioniert ja beim IO-Broker LoveLace nicht, oder?
Danke, viele Grüße.
-
@allgrind said in Test Adapter lovelace v1.2.x:
Hey,
die neue Version sieht wirklich super aus!Gleichwohl habe ich immer noch das Problem mit ACCU-Weather:
Raum Any und Funktion Weather wurden eingestellt. Auch die Custom-Card wurde installiert. Leider erkennt der Detector aber nicht das Objekt:[Type-Detector] device accuweather.0.Summary.CurrentDateTime - info - accuweather.0.Summary is not yet supported
Das ist richtig, für Accuweather braucht man einen modifizierten type-adapter (siehe Github), mit dem Nachteil, dass man die zukünftige Entwicklungen verpasst / Probleme mit anderen Entitäten auftauchen könnten. Seitdem nutze ich den Daswetter Adapter mit der "normalen" Wetter Karte.
-
Hey, hat von euch jemand den Customheader zum laufen gebracht oder ist das in der IOB Version von Lovelace schlicht nicht möglich, ich beiß mir hier die Zähne dran aus.
MFG
CrunkFX -
@Tirador
Uh.. das mit dem Leerzeichen darf nicht sein. Da muss ich gucken. Danke für den Report!//Edit: Huch.. an dem Code für manuelle Entities hat sich überhaupt nichts geändert..
//Edit2: Ok, gefunden. Ist seit 1.1.0 drin der Bug. Lustig, dass es bisher keinem sonst aufgefallen ist.
Wenn du schonmal testen möchtest, kannst du mit dieser Github "URL" installieren:Garfonso/iobroker.lovelace#dev
(so einfügen als beliebige URL) -
@allgrind said in Test Adapter lovelace v1.2.x:
Gleichwohl habe ich immer noch das Problem mit ACCU-Weather:
Raum Any und Funktion Weather wurden eingestellt. Auch die Custom-Card wurde installiert. Leider erkennt der Detector aber nicht das Objekt:[Type-Detector] device accuweather.0.Summary.CurrentDateTime - info - accuweather.0.Summary is not yet supported
Dafür gibt es bisher keinen fix. Das System ist immer noch das alte, du kannst den modifizierten type-detector von dem Autor installieren, dann geht es. Wobei sich Lovelace auch verändert hat, so dass die custom-card nicht mehr gut aussieht...
Des Weiteren habe ich leider nur einen Zustandsverlauf bei Sensorwerten, wo die History im Datenpunkt selbst aktiv ist.
Wie klappt das bei Hue-Lampen oder bei Rollladen?Lösung: - > Einfach beim entsprechenden Gerät / Typ die History aktivieren.
Hat das dein Problem gelöst? grübel Also in ioBroker history anmachen? Ja, die braucht man natürlich.
Leider wird der Shelly-Dimmer nicht mehr korrekt erkannt. Gibt es eine Möglichkeit den TypeDector manuell anzupassen?
Nein. Das beste für diese Art von Probleme ist es mit dem Geräte-Adapter alias-Geräte anzulegen. (der type-detector ist nur eine Komponente, den der lovelace adapter nutzt, der wird auch von anderem, z.B. dem Geräte-Adapter, genutzt).
-
im Zuge der "Geräte" bzw alias wollte ich mich mal wieder an Lovelace ranwagen weil fürs Handy bekommt man ja so eine schöne einfache Ansicht, Aber egal was ich mache, die Aliase die ich erstelle tauchen nicht in Lovelace auf. jemand einen Tipp??
-
@Meistertr zeig mal bitte Screenshots wie du die Funktionen UND Räume den Datenpunkten zugeordnet hast.
-
@Garfonso OK super. Werde die Testversion versuchen heute Abend durchzutesten und gebe dann Feedback.
-
-
@Meistertr OK, du nutzt anscheinend den devices-Adapter. Damit habe ich noch keine Erfahrungen und kann dir nicht helfen.
Warum probierst du es nicht erstmal mit der Automatik durch Zuordnung von Rolle und Funktion auf den Datenpunkten?
-
@Garfonso Ich habe die DEV-Version getestet. Sieht alles perfekt aus.
In der alten Testversion gab es noch Probleme mit der Wetterkarte. Das ist nun auch gefixt.
Besonders gut gefallen hat mir, dass bei den Fenstern nun auch "geöffnet" / "geschlossen" steht, statt "an" und "aus". Das wäre für die Wassermelder auch fancy -
Ein wenig Werbung in eigener Sache.
Ich habe versucht die Erkenntnisse aus vielen Beiträgen im Forum in einem Leitfaden zu bündeln:https://forum.iobroker.net/topic/35937/der-ultimative-iobroker-lovelace-leitfaden-dokumentation
Mein Versuch war davon geprägt auch genauer zu dokumentieren, wie die Entity Erkennung Automatisch / Manuell erfolgt.
-
@Meistertr
ich hab das issue gesehen, danke dafür, so ist das gut angelegt.Ich vermute, dass es daher kommt, dass es kein "ON" state gibt... das mag der adapter aktuell (noch) nicht. Ich werde sehen, wie ich das verarbeiten kann. Mit manuellen Lichtern geht "nur dimmen", bei automatischen geht das aktuell nicht, da wird immer nach An/Aus state gesucht. Daher wäre ein zu testender Workaround auch ein an/aus state mit ins Alias Gerät zu packen.
-
@Garfonso mit der eingespielten Dev Version kann ich keine Mediensteuerungen hinzufügen. Es scheint etwas zu fehlen:
-
@Tirador
Geht hier. Du warst vorher auf was unter 1.2, richtig? Hast du mal versucht den Browsercache für die Seite zu löschen?
Oder passiert es "nur" bei sonos? (Hab ich leider nicht, hab es mit einem selbstgebastelten = alias Alexa player versucht). Aber loading chunk 4 failed heißt, es würde was an Dateien für das Frontend fehlen. Das würde mich etwas wundern. -
@Garfonso vorher war ich auf 1.0.5. Ich habe dann über deinen geposteten Link "Garfonso/iobroker.lovelace#dev" die aktuelle DEV installiert aus deinem GIT Repository.
Leider hat das Browser Cache leeren nichts gebracht. Ich kann aber trotzdem keine neuen Karten hinzufügen, da steht dann immer unten "Verbindung getrennt. Verbinde erneut..".
Im Log ist erkennbar, dass etwas nicht richtig klappt "(32151) uncaught exception: mime.lookup is not a function" . Der Adapter startet dann auch ständig neuhost.iobroker 2020-08-15 17:35:28.392 info Restart adapter system.adapter.lovelace.0 because enabled host.iobroker 2020-08-15 17:35:28.391 info instance system.adapter.lovelace.0 terminated with code 0 (NO_ERROR) lovelace.0 2020-08-15 17:35:27.804 info (32151) Terminated (NO_ERROR): Without reason lovelace.0 2020-08-15 17:35:27.802 info (32151) terminating lovelace.0 2020-08-15 17:35:27.781 info (32151) cleaned everything up... lovelace.0 2020-08-15 17:35:27.780 error (32151) TypeError: mime.lookup is not a function at /opt/iobroker/node_modules/iobroker.lovelace/lib/server.js:3880:44 at /opt/iobroker/node_modules/iobroker.js-controller/lib/adapter.js:2870: lovelace.0 2020-08-15 17:35:27.772 error (32151) uncaught exception: mime.lookup is not a function
Ich habe auch noch eine zweite Exception:
lovelace.0 2020-08-15 17:44:25.651 info (31117) Terminated (NO_ERROR): Without reason lovelace.0 2020-08-15 17:44:25.650 info (31117) terminating lovelace.0 2020-08-15 17:44:25.636 info (31117) cleaned everything up... lovelace.0 2020-08-15 17:44:25.635 error at processTicksAndRejections (internal/process/task_queues.js:97:5) lovelace.0 2020-08-15 17:44:25.635 error at /opt/iobroker/node_modules/standard-as-callback/built/index.js:19:49 lovelace.0 2020-08-15 17:44:25.635 error at tryCatcher (/opt/iobroker/node_modules/standard-as-callback/built/utils.js:11:23) lovelace.0 2020-08-15 17:44:25.635 error at /opt/iobroker/node_modules/iobroker.objects-redis/index.js:1:93703 lovelace.0 2020-08-15 17:44:25.635 error at /opt/iobroker/node_modules/iobroker.js-controller/lib/adapter.js:2870:21 lovelace.0 2020-08-15 17:44:25.635 error at /opt/iobroker/node_modules/iobroker.lovelace/lib/server.js:3880:44 lovelace.0 2020-08-15 17:44:25.635 error (31117) TypeError: mime.lookup is not a function lovelace.0 2020-08-15 17:44:25.631 error (31117) uncaught exception: mime.lookup is not a function
-
Anmerkung zum chunkfehler oben. Die Meldung kommt bestimmt im Browser Client. Sie sagt im Prinzip aus, dass der Server nicht verfügbar ist. Ist ja auch logisch, wenn er ständig neustartet.